Grant Description
Dependant upon funding availability. As part of this endangered species outreach effort, the refuge along with its partners organize and hold a Riparian Brush Rabbit Festival each year which seeks to promote public interest in the brush rabbit, endangered species, other riparian wildlife, and riparian habitats. Information booths, guided tours to riparian habitats and youth events are provided at the festival. This project will promote the event and aid in providing educational materials on riparian habitats and the brush rabbit.
